Asus Eee PC Seashell Announced

Asus has just announced the Eee PC Seashell – a netbook that comes in an opalescent glossy exterior, manufactured through the use of In-Mold Roller technology. In fact, the surface will simulate the effects of light sprinkling of fine sand on the exterior of a seashell. Doesn’t sound too much like a businessperson’s netbook, eh? Well, opening it is somewhat akin to ptying open an oyster, but you won’t find any pearls inside apart from the following :-

  • 10″ LED-backlit WSVGA glare-type display
  • Ergonomically designed keyboard
  • 160GB 2.5″ SATA II hard drive
  • 10GB online Eee Storage
  • Wi-Fi-n connectivity
  • Multitouch trackpad

There is no word on how much the Eee PC Seashell will cost though, but it shouldn’t amount to more than an expensive necklace of pearls.
